Osteoporosis is a condition that weakens bones, making them more susceptible to fractures. Diagnosing osteoporosis often involves a medical imaging, which measures the strength of your bones. Your doctor will also consider your health records and family background of osteoporosis. Treatment for osteoporosis typically includes lifestyle changes, such as strength training and a diet rich in calcium, along with medications that can slow bone loss.

  • Early detection of osteoporosis is crucial for preventing fractures and maintaining bone health.

Exploring Medications for Osteoporosis Management

Osteoporosis is a debilitating bone condition that can lead to increased risk of fractures. Fortunately, there are a variety of treatments available to help control the progression of this significant condition. Some common types of osteoporosis medication include bisphosphonates, which halt bone breakdown, and selective estrogen receptor modulators (SERMs), which adjust the effects of estrogen in bone tissue. Thriving with Osteoporosis: Medication Strategies and Healthy Habits

Osteoporosis can significantly impact quality of life, however with the right approach, you can effectively manage its effects. Medical interventions play a crucial role in improving bone density and reducing the risk of fractures. Your doctor may prescribe medications such as bisphosphonates, denosumab, or teriparatide to stop bone loss and promote new bone formation.

Alongside medication, adopting a healthy lifestyle is essential for living well osteoporosis. Healthy diet rich in calcium and vitamin D is crucial for strong bones. Frequent weight-bearing exercise, like walking or dancing, builds bone density. Additionally, quitting smoking and limiting alcohol intake can benefit your bone health.

  • Furthermore, maintaining a healthy weight and avoiding falls are important for preventing osteoporosis-related fractures.
